Research conducted by MORI, amongst 187 senior board directors of the UK's leading companies, concluded that '94% agree that the asset which offers the greatest protection during an economic downturn is a strong brand'. There are three reasons for this: Confidence - Loyal customers retain confidence in a strong brand even when the going gets tough. Confident customers are less likely to switch brand. Risk - potential customers, staff and shareholders are more risk averse during a recession. Strong brand mitigates risk in the mind of the stakeholder.
